Total Cash on Hand

Total cash on hand represents the amount of readily liquid cash a business has at any given point. It includes money held in diverse forms, such as currency, checking accounts, total cash and fluid investments. This metric is crucial for evaluating a company's financial health as it reflects its ability to satisfy immediate liabilities. A healthy cash on hand balance provides a cushion against unforeseen expenses and allows for strategic decision-making.

Comprehending Total Cash Reserves

Total cash reserves indicate the total amount of liquid assets a organization has on hand. This sum is crucial for measuring a company's financial stability, as it reflects its ability to handle short-term obligations and seize opportunities. A healthy cash reserve ensures a buffer against unforeseen expenditures and allows for calculated investments. Reviewing a company's total cash reserves can offer valuable insights into its financial position.
